Where is the Birnage family from?

You can see how Birnage families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Birnage family name was found in the UK in 1891. In 1891 there were 7 Birnage families living in Hampshire. This was about 58% of all the recorded Birnage's in United Kingdom. Hampshire had the highest population of Birnage families in 1891.
